Check Out Jack-8’s Tekken 8 Gameplay Trailer

The 'Hi-tech Annihilator' is back, and is bringing the big guns.

Bandai Namco has dropped another Tekken 8 gameplay trailer, this time featuring Jack-8, the Mohawked android originally created by Mishima Zaibatsu in the original Tekken. You can check out the trailer below:

In the trailer, Jack-8 looks like an improved version of Jack-7. It now has a visor and a summonable giant drill/laser cannon-hybrid weapon thingy, in addition to looking like a finalised version of Gun Jack (also known as ‘Jack-3,’ who was introduced in Tekken 3 back in 1997).

Currently in development for the P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C via Steam, Tekken 8 is a sequel to 2017’s Tekken 7, and features an upgraded visual style powered by Unreal Engine.

Although no release date has been announced, Bandai Namco has revealed that Jin Kazama, Kazuya Mishima, Jun Kazama, Nina Williams, Paul Phoenix, Marshall Law, Lars Alexandersson, and Jack-8 will return as playable characters in Tekken 8.
